Heads up for the release: the WaveGlance preview renderer kept timing out on the Pindrop CI pool because ffprobe wasn't cached between stages. Added a warm-cache step and it's green again. Nothing user-facing changed, so no hold needed. If you want to verify, the passing build is stamped with the token below.

pipeline stamp: htk31_f769b577b3028a4e9958e5bb8d1259a

# StageGrid settings — seat-map renderer for the Marlowe Playhouse frontend.
# New team members: the renderer reads venue layouts and hold states from
# Postgres, then caches computed SVG tiles in memory. Most keys here are safe
# defaults; only touch TILE_SIZE if the design team changes seat dimensions.
# The renderer connects to the layouts database using the value below.

primary connection of fahag-kawig = mysql://gilath_svc:ycU1T0imceeaI4@db-27dd.norvastack.example:5432/silwyn

TICKET-DLR-4471: Vault locked, deep-link routing blocked

The Skippernet signing vault auto-locked after three failed attempts Tuesday. Mobile deep-link routing changes for Larkline can't ship until we re-sign the manifest. Need sign-off at sync before unlocking. Per policy, the vault reopens only with the recovery passphrase noted below.

unlock words, fadug-tageg: zorix-wenwyn-quenmir

// Client setup for ParityScope, our internal hotel rate-parity checker.
// It compares nightly rates across the Lumen Suites and Harborfell
// properties against third-party listings and flags mismatches over 2%.
// Requests are rate-limited to 30/min, so keep batch sizes small.
// Authentication uses a static key passed in the request header, shown here.

app token of kafop-hahaf = kto11_iRLdsMBafGn

## Configuration

This repo contains the tooling we used to investigate cron drift on the Harrowgate batch hosts, where jobs were firing up to ninety seconds late. The collector samples scheduler wakeups and ships deltas to the Tidemark metrics store. Reviewers should check that DRIFT_SAMPLE_RATE stays at or below 10 per minute and that DRIFT_HOSTS lists only batch-tier machines. Everything is configured through a single .env file at the repo root. The write credential for the metrics store belongs on the following line.

sealed setting: ARCHIVE_KEY3=8d0